    Job Title: Test Engineer

    Job Description

    We are seeking a Test Engineer who will be responsible for designing, assembling, and testing fixtures, as well as implementing quality procedures for our products. This role involves analyzing product features, developing test parameters, troubleshooting issues, and authoring final test procedures and reports for the Sustaining Engineering team. The Test Engineer will ensure all tests and procedures meet company and industry standards, streamline testing processes, and prepare accurate test reports.

    Responsibilities

    + Design, assemble, and test fixtures.

    + Implement quality procedures for products.

    + Analyze product features and develop test parameters.

    + Troubleshoot issues and author final test procedures and reports.

    + Ensure all tests and procedures meet company and industry standards.

    + Streamline testing processes and prepare accurate test reports.

    Essential Skills

    + Experience with test equipment such as oscilloscopes, multimeters, logic analyzers, and signal generators.

    + Strong understanding of PCB design, schematics, and debugging techniques.

    + Proven ability to troubleshoot and repair analog and digital circuits at the component level.

    + Experience with automated test systems and fixture design (mechanical and electrical).

    + Proficiency in test development tools and languages (e.g., LabVIEW, Python, Test Stand, C/C++).

    Additional Skills & Qualifications

    + Experience supporting sustaining engineering and managing product lifecycle issues.

    + Familiarity with Lean Manufacturing, Six Sigma, or ISO 9001 practices.

    + Experience working with contract manufacturers and global supply chains.

    + Knowledge of component lifecycle management tools and change control processes.

     

    Work Environment

     

    The role is based in a medical device manufacturing facility, offering a clean working environment.
